1747
Provinzen Brabant, Limburg, Luxemburg, Geldern, Flandern, Artois, Hennegau, Namur, Mecheln, Antwerpen, Wappen von den zehn Provinzen, Gebietsgrenzen farblich markiert, Zeichenerklärung, aufgeführt sind befestigte Städte, Burgen, Klöster, Kirchen und Sümpfe: Carte des Pais Bas catholiques ou des X provinces de l'Allemagne inferieure etc. Dessinee, au juste selon les exactes observations Astronomiques et Operations Geometriques des Messur. Cassini. Snellius. Muschenbrok etc. dresse par Sr Tobias Maier. Mathematicien. Aux depens des Heritiers de Homann. L An. 1747. Aves Privil Imperial Belgium Catholicum seu Decem Provinciae Germaniae Inferioris cum confiniis Germaniae Sup. et Franciae legitime omnia delineata et ad ductum observationum astronomicarum nec non Geometricarum operationum a cassinio snellio Muschenbrokio aliisque rite habitarum examinata studiosissime et representata a Tob. Maiero. Math. Cult. Edentibus Hommannianis Heredib
Tobias Maier, Homann-Erben Verlag
Papier, teilweise kolorierter Kupferstich

BZK no.
The Bundeszentralkartei (BZK) is the central register of the federal government and federal states for completed compensation proceedings. When a claim is entered into the BZK, a number is assigned for unique identification. This BZK number refers to a compensation claim, not to a person. If a person has made several claims (e.g. for themselves and for relatives), each claim generally has its own BZK number. Often, the file number of the respective compensation authority is used as the BZK number.
This number is important for making an inquiry to the relevant archive.
